Oakland police Chief Anne Kirkpatrick was fired from her job late Thursday, according to the mayor and the Oakland Police Commission.

Kirkpatrick was terminated without cause by the Oakland Police Commission and Mayor Libby Schaaf during a special closed session meeting at City Hall. Darren Allison will step in as acting chief until an interim chief is appointed.
